Cam Chain Tensioners

I had time to check the travel on the rear tensioner after getting home from work. The end of the bar is 7/32" from being flush with the end of the threaded body. I will check the front tensioner on my days off this week. I'm shy of 1/4" travel by 1/32" at 23,000 miles. Gadjet's instructions state that being 3/8" from the end of the threaded body is fully extended. So, I have about 5/32" of travel left on the rear tensioner. Guess I should order the extenders with Joe to have them on hand when I need them.

Cam Chain Tensioners

Mitch,
I still have the original air set-up; for carburetion, so the FI set-up is probably different. For the front cylinder I removed the left air cleaner, filter and the plate that holds the filter. I removed fuel tank and the intake box. I removed the intake between the cylinders to get the cross over tube out of the way. I also removed the crossover tube from the back of the carb. We can take a look at your bike in a couple of weeks and see.

I was thinking the intake was going to be more difficult to remove, but I didn't think it was too tough of a job. Plus, now I think I'll tackle a new Thunder intake after removing this stuff to get at the front tensioner.
